Output 38fccd6f81911a1009bc92f4f3c54f8fa8d090acfbc81bae859cf3a0b08d8491:1

value
2377145431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2b4ae12e32ec0f3442773c0a72379d168448dc8 OP_EQUAL
address
3KSXTd8DRMy4Y2eQuAEZuzkEqVLpU1yE3W
transaction
38fccd6f81911a1009bc92f4f3c54f8fa8d090acfbc81bae859cf3a0b08d8491
spent
true